All of roca partida is amazing, it’s one of the coolest far away places I have ever been.  It seems to be there still a balanced ecosystem, which in the world today is very difficult to find.  I think that roca is a place where we can learn quite a bit about our behaviour. I am thankful that all these big sharks and fish are still somewhere like roca partida..there are so few places left on this planet, that I call it fish soup because it has everything together.  Also I went on a zodiac bird watching outing to see all the birds on roca close up and take fotos and I can say how brave these birds are to come all this way to hunt.  Very nice.  Claudia

Roca is just a fantastic place, we see almost all the same as yesterday, the sharks and mantas and fish, but it was just as amazing the second time around.  Torsten (nicknamed special k by tigre).

I was at this great spot off the south point at thirty two meters and I had el tigre a meter or two above me, and we were both appreciating the many different types of sharks that were coming so very close, the Galapagos and white tips, and also the hammerheads, it was a shame that the hammerheads did not come as close as the others, it is not in their nature, that would have made it even better.  Something for next time∑  Goetz.

My last day at roca was just great, lots of sharks and mantas too, I made the four dives of the day and the last dive of the day I made fifteen minutes and then had to retreat to six meters because my computer was saturated, I had used up all my bottom time on the first three dives, and even at six meters it was great.  Volker.
